Transaction dfc28dac3f167eafec99e96b7ffc95c26f97a6997dfa8b5258def7bfa96f8d2e

37 Input
1 Outputs
  • dfc28dac3f167eafec99e96b7ffc95c26f97a6997dfa8b5258def7bfa96f8d2e:0
  • value  1626289703
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h